Daytona with diamond bezel and 8 diamonds on the face

I just inherited a Daytona with the diamond bezel. The jeweler tells me it's legit but I can't seem to find a Daytona with diamonds that is probably stainless steel. Several are white gold with the diamonds. I'm new at all this. The numbers on the back of the case are worn off so I have no idea about model number. Any advice welcomed.

You'll be able to find the serial number on the little ring that surrounds the dial on the inside of the watch (look at the 6th marker, it's right besides it). If it's not there, you must take the bracelet off and take a look in between the lugs.

Would it be possible to see pictures of the watch? If it's made of stainless steel and it's a real watch then the bezel and the dial are probably aftermarket (unless the former owner found original ones).
